A rite of passage is a series of rituals that conveys an individual from one social state or status to another for example, from adolescence to adulthood, from single to married, from student to graduate, from apprentice to a full member of a profession, from life to death thereby. Van gennep was the first observer of human behaviour to note that the ritual ceremonies that accompany the landmarks of human life differ only in detail from one culture to another, and that they are in essence universal. In japan, the second monday of january marks a special day the day in which 20 year olds get to dress up in their finest traditional attire, attend a ceremony in local city offices, receive gifts, and party to their hearts content amongst friends and family.
